ABOUT mACHADO

Multi-instrumentalist and Portland native Machado Mijiga wears many hats, both literally and metaphorically. Classically trained, jazz-weathered, and eclectically inclined, Mijiga left the proverbial creative “box” at a very early age, with access to many instruments and a diverse musical background brought about by an intercultural heritage. Mijiga is a musical polymath; composer, producer, bandleader, educator, gear fanatic, and audio engineer, to name a few. Authenticity and uniquity assume the locus of Mijiga’s artistic identity. Self-expression is the prime directive and the medium of choice changes like the weather.

ABOUT AMENTA

Yawa is a songwriter and producer from Memphis, TN. She is currently based in Portland, OR. In her one-woman performance, she builds vocal and instrumental loops from synth, drum machine, and  kalimba creating atmospheric textures. Yawa surprises and tantalizes audiences with mind bending ideas while skipping vocally from soul-shaking gospel to smooth jazz.

THE KEY & THE TOWERS | SANTIGIE & SAPATA FOFANA-DURA

MAY 1- AUGUST 26, 2023 | THE AMERICA WALDO BOGLE GALLERY AT THE BUSH HOUSE MUSEUM

Bush House Museum is proud to present The Key & The Towers by brothers Santigie and Sapata Fofana-Dura in the Waldo Bogle Gallery this summer.  The exhibition features three new sculptures created from found wood and metal. Each piece is finished with a deep intensional burning process, leaving a velvet black surface on the work. In addition, there will be an accompanying performance by Santigie titled “The Door” happening inside the gallery.

About The artists

Sapata and Santigie design and build architectural sculpture that hinges around the storyteller.  The artists create work imbued with a rugged elegance as they exclusively construct their work with abandoned timber salvaged from the Pacific Northwest.  Through a dynamic of contemporary and craft inspired construction methods the artists create work with the intention to tell new stories with a classic style.  Santigie.com
